Where It Shines (and Where It Needs Extra Care)

Blessed to Be Called Mom, Mom Lover Tees works beautifully on:

But here’s where attention is non-negotiable:

  1. Thin or stretchy fabric: On lightweight jersey tees, use cut-away stabilizer underneath *and* topping—this phrase relies on even tension to keep curves smooth.
  2. Dark fabric: That high-res PNG (4500 × 5400) is ideal for mockups, but in real stitching, test thread contrast first—cream on charcoal can vanish if stitch density runs too low.
  3. Curved surfaces: Caps or curved tote handles require re-hooping or digitizing adjustments. This file isn’t pre-digitized for caps—it’s a graphic, so treat it as a starting point, not a plug-and-play embroidery file.
  4. Dense stitch areas: The lowercase “o” and “a” have tight interior spaces. Zoom in on your embroidery software—check for under-stitching or overlapping fills that could cause thread breaks.

Why Craft Business Owners Should Pause Before Adding It to Their Shop

If you sell finished embroidered products—or digital embroidery files—you need more than aesthetic appeal. You need reliability, scalability, and trust. Blessed to Be Called Mom, Mom Lover Tees delivers mood and message, but remember: it arrives as vector and raster assets (AI, EPS, SVG, PNG), not native embroidery formats like .PES or .DST. That means you handle the digitizing—or hire someone who does. For Etsy sellers bundling “ready-to-stitch” designs, this is a workflow consideration, not a dealbreaker—but it changes your time investment.

Also: licensing. The listing says “We are always making new designs,” but doesn’t specify commercial use terms. If you plan to sell embroidered tote bags with this phrase, verify whether redistribution or derivative use is permitted. When in doubt, reach out to the creator before listing.
